NUTR 210 Introduction to Nutrition

The choices we make about food and nutrition shape our health and wellness throughout our lives. This course examines the factors that influence dietary choices, including cultural influences, personal preferences, and food accessibility. Students will explore macronutrients, micronutrients, governmental dietary guidelines, and practical assessment tools used to design nutrition plans that support health, well-being, and weight management across the lifespan.
